Is it possible for my phone to notify with a notification sound when a text has been sent to me from the contact who text thread I am currently in. When I am the text thread for my mom and I read her text but didn't exit out of the thread. I noticed when she sends me another text I get no notification sound or alert. I would like to change this setting if possible but can't figure out how to do so. Please help

settings, notifications, messages, category new messages, make sure it's on and style has sound. then... current conversation, top right info, notifications (default), select custom, select sound, back to conversation, info, btm right, bell, select so it's on. lastly, settings, sound, turn on vibration for all phone and messaging so it'll at least vibrate in conversation for new recieved texts.
